Fire Sale. How to rebuild the Lions.

So here I sit watching the Lions get stomped by the Bears (Kyle Orton is my awesome QB pick of the week for fantasy by the way) and I wonder if the Lions have any hope to improve in the next few years.  The Lions play with no passion, no drive, and hardly look like they are interested in the game.  Rod Marinelli just finally benched Kitna, only to play Dan Orlovski.  Roy Williams is blaming everything but his hands for why he isn't catching the ball.  This is sad.  I say it's time to trim some fat and let the new guys play.

First things first, fire Marinelli.  The man is lost, and has no hope of fixing this team.  At halftime Rod said "We know what we need to do we just need to start doing it".  Duh.  Even assuming the Lions as a team know what to do, there is no reason to believe they can do it.  Marinelli came in to Detroit preaching fundamentals, defense, and dedication and this team has no idea about any of them.  The tackling is the worst in the league, the defense is pathetic and the only dedication I see in Detroit is William Clay Fords dedication to Rod Marinelli.  Rod Marinelli has been hindered by Matt Millen, but the choices for offensive and defensive COs came from Marinelli and are just wrong.  Son in law can't lead a pee wee football teams defense to victory and Jim Coletto just is not O-line coordinator quality. 

Does firing Marinelli make the Lions better?  No not at all.  In fact finding an interm or even new head coach at this point in the season would be very hard.  But it again pacifies the fans, and WCF needs to do as much of that as possible.  The Lions need a GM and a new head coach.  A quaterback a new offensive line, some DBs that can tackle, I mean the list goes on.  Here is my solution.

Hire Floyd Reese as GM.  This is the guy that made the Tennesee Titans the team they are today.  He can evaluate talent, he has some kind of draft crystal ball, and he is not Matt Millen.  This man is asking for the job.  He wants to come to Detroit, and I can't imagine he is just looking for Millen like job security.  Reese must see something here in Detroit that he can work with.  I say hire him, give him 3 years and see what happens.

Find Bill Cowher and pay him whatever he asks.  Marty Shottinheimer is another option.  The guy took his last team to a 14-2 record before getting fired.  Either way you are getting a quality head coach with a proven track record.  Personally I think Cowher would be a better fit here, he is a take no #### kind of guy and that is what the Lions need.  Rod Marinelli is supposed to be that guy now, but he hasn't lived up to the hype.  Cowher will come in here, clean house and smack some heads until this team listens.  I will give WCF some credit, he sticks with a head coach until they have proven they can not get the job done, unlike Al Davis.  So give Cowher the reins, 4 years, and a GM he can work with and turn him loose.

Next on the agenda, clean house.  Kitna is worthless as the Lions quarterback, the guy is not the future here.  Trade him now while he still has some value to a team that has a shot.  The Patriots need a quarterback so let's make a deal.  Kitna has enough skill to lead a team like the Patriots into the playoffs, easily.  So get a 3rd round draft pick for him.  Hell float the conditional draft pick idea like Green Bay did with Favre.  Detroit gets a 3rd round, a 2nd round if the Pats make the playoffs, and a 1st round if they win the Super Bowl.  Even going 4th, 3rd, 2nd makes sense.  It is time for Drew Stanton to get his shot as the starter, so the team can see if he is the answer for the future.  I doubt it myself.  Stanton in the second round was one of the worst reaches I've seen in the draft in years, but the guy deserves a chance to prove himself.

Next up on the chopping block, Rudi Johnson.  Send him to Pittsburgh for a 4th or 5th round pick.  He isn't worth that much sitting on the Detroit sidelines so get what you can for him.  The Steelers are hurting for a decent RB and Johnson can fill in until FWP is healthy.

This one makes me happy inside.  Let's ship Roy Williams to Dallas for a 2nd round pick.  The Lions are going nowhere this year so why keep all this dead weight around?  Roy Williams doesn't want to stay here in Detroit, is gone in 3 months anyways, why not try to get something of value for him?  Jerry Jones would love to see Williams line up across from T.O.  Another good place for Williams is Cleveland.  The Browns are going to stick with Anderson because they spent so much money on him, so why not try to pry Brady Quinn off the bench and into the silver and blue?  Of course it's gonna cost Detroit more than Williams to get Quinn, but I think adding a late round pick would be worth it.

Those three players are the only ones on the Detroit roster that any other team is going to show interest in besides Ernie Sims, and to give him up would be insanity.  Sims is going to be the cornerstone of the Lions new defense, and I hope he is ready for that.  Personally I would like to see the Lions cut everyone but Sims, Kevin Smith, Stanton, Calvin Johnson, and maybe Gosder, and sign jobbers for the league minimum and play this year and the next.  Detroit is so #### up when it comes to the salary cap that they need two years of a 20 million dollar roster to make room to rebuild. 

This is my way of making the Lions better, even though it may take two to three years to pay off.  We need draft picks, and lots of them to make a difference.  Lemmie know what you think, any better ideas or trades out there?
